tir, 14.06.2005 kl. 17.47 skrev Jason Signalness:
> Help!! I'm struggling with ldapsam.
>
> I'm trying to configure Samba to use our LDAP directory (Sun's directory
> server) for the storage of Samba user accounts. It already stores our
> unix system accounts. I have successfully imported the schema file into
> our directory server and have compiled samba with the
> "--prefix=/opt/btifs/samba --with-ldapsam" options. I did not notice
> any errors during compile.
>
> When I go to start Samba (smbd -D), the daemon dies quickly and this
> error is written to the log:
>
> smbd version 3.0.14a started.
> Copyright Andrew Tridgell and the Samba Team 1992-2004
> [2005/06/14 09:09:02, 0] passdb/pdb_interface.c:make_pdb_methods_name(721)
> No builtin nor plugin backend for ldapsam_compat found
> [2005/06/14 09:09:02, 1] passdb/pdb_interface.c:make_pdb_context_list(825)
> Loading ldapsam_compat failed!
>
> Here is my smb.conf file:
>
> [global]
> workgroup = BTIWG1
> netbios name = FS1V
> encrypt passwords = Yes
> allow trusted domains = No
> log level = 1
> guest account = nobody
> map to guest = Bad User
> # passdb backend = ldapsam:ldap://ce.btinet.net
> # ldap admin dn = cn=Directory Manager
> # ldap suffix = ou=People,o=tildebob.com,o=usergroups
Why did you comment out all the stuff you need?
Even if you hadn't, your ldap admin dn = cn=Directory Manager wouldn't
work, it's not qualified with the rest of the suffix.
Also, the ldap suffix is probably wrong. In fact, your whole DIT is
probably incorrectly implemented :(
You'd also be missing the machine, group and user suffixes, unless
they're under the ldap suffix.
